Christofle Carrousel: A Philosophy All Its Own
For centuries, the cutlery sets of kings and aristocrats held a status equal to that of treasured gems. Driven by this idea, the brand and Parisian designer Charlotte Chesnais—renowned for the exclusive forms of her creations, especially her iconic rings—launched a daring project to reconnect with tradition and reestablish tableware as a mark of distinction. In a first for the house, each piece was created to go beyond function at the table, delighting with sculptural magnificence: the items carry perforated details and fluid, jewelry-like lines, and the case itself looks more like an outstanding design object than simple storage. The whole point of this collab is the idea to make cutlery as delicate and striking as rings or pendants. And when the pieces are tucked into the box, the set itself turns into a sculpture destined to be admired as an artful installation.
What Makes Christofle Carrousel So Impressive
From the very first sight, it’s the case that captures attention, shattering all traditional notions of what storage should be. Instead of a standard box, you receive an artistic form that doubles as a work of art: crafted from fine walnut veneer, it features a geometric shape that opens up into a mini carousel spinning 180 degrees.
The top is stainless steel with a mirror polish, and the moving part is finished in gold PVD, giving it the shine and feel of real precious metal.
Carrousel Christofle Options
The Christofle Carrousel collection comes in a range of beautiful options. The collection begins with the essentials—refined sets for six (24 pieces) or for twelve (48 pieces), perfectly tailored to advance both intimate dinners and grand gatherings.
Currently, the line is composed of four essential dining tools: the fork, the dinner spoon, the dessert spoon, and the table knife. Beyond the full set, there’s the option to purchase additional bundles of utensils, perfect if you need more pieces for larger gatherings.
As for materials, Christofle offers pure silver-plated pieces alongside extraordinary silver-plated, partially gilded with 18k gold flatware (where a single side of the handle gleams with gold, adding contrast and a jewel-like touch).
